I am writing to follow up on a payment withdrawal request that I initiated on 29.06.2024. According to your payment policy, the process should take between 7 to 10 business days. However, as of today, 09.07.2024, I have not yet received the payment.

Could you please provide an update on the status of this withdrawal? Any assistance or information you can offer would be greatly appreciated.

Again...7 to 10 business days. Between the 29th of June and July 8 (today), only 5 business days have passed. Weekends do not count. There was also a US holiday on the 4th. That is not a business day. You requested payment on a Saturday. That Saturday and the following Sunday, would not count as business days, nor would the 6th and 7th of July.

A business day is from Monday to Friday, excluding public and company holidays. So 10 days (you should not expect the payment earlier, but typically, it comes earlier) means at least two full weeks!

 

I've never understood why people are always so impatient? Anyhow, only after the status changes from “pending” to “done” has Adobe transferred the funds to your payment agent. You will need to check with them, when there is a delay after that.
